一、簡介 Python是一門功能強大的高級腳本語言,它的強大不僅表現在其自身的功能上,而且還表現在其良好的可擴展性上,正因如此,Python已經開始受到越來越多人的青睞,並且被屢屢成功地應用於各類大型軟件系統的開發過程中。 與其它普通腳本語言有所不同,Python程序員可以借助Python語言 ...
PyObject對象機制的基石 學過Python的人應該非常清晰,Python中一切都是對象,全部的對象都有一個共同的基類,對於本篇博文來說,一切皆是對象則是探索Python的對象機制的一個入口點 我如果讀者在閱讀本文的時候已經下載Python Python . . 的源代碼,而且已經解壓進入了源代碼的根文件夾下 眾所周知Python是用C實現的,C是一種OO的語言。而Python是一個OOP的 ...
2018-01-23 20:09 0 4251 推薦指數:
一、簡介 Python是一門功能強大的高級腳本語言,它的強大不僅表現在其自身的功能上,而且還表現在其良好的可擴展性上,正因如此,Python已經開始受到越來越多人的青睞,並且被屢屢成功地應用於各類大型軟件系統的開發過程中。 與其它普通腳本語言有所不同,Python程序員可以借助Python語言 ...
============================================= example2: ...
楔子 我們在上一篇中說到了,面向對象理論中"類"和"對象"這兩個概念在Python內部都是通過"對象"實現的。"類"是一種對象,稱為"類型對象","類"實例化得到的也是"對象",稱為"實例對象"。 並且根據對象的不同特點還可以進一步分類: 可變對象:對象創建之后可以本地修改; 不可 ...
目錄 簡介 內置函數 內置常量 內置類型 邏輯值檢測 邏輯值的布爾運算 比較運算 數字類型 ...
Java中的內部類雖然在狀態信息上與其外圍類在狀態信息是完全獨立的(可直接通過內部類實例執行其功能),但是外圍類對象卻是內部類對象得以存在的基礎。 內部類對象生成的時候,必須要保證其能夠有外圍類對象進行掛靠(hook),從而java提供了嚴格的內部類對象生成的語法。 一般慣用兩種方法,生成 ...
python中,當程序執行完畢之后,python的垃圾回收機制就會將所有對象回收,清除占用的內存 請看如下代碼 解釋:上面定義了兩個類父類Parent和子類Child,子類繼承父類。執行測試的兩行代碼,創建了兩個對象,一個子類對象ch,一個父類對象fc。因為類中顯式定義 ...
最近一直在研究runtime運行時機制的問題,我想可能也有很多人不太清楚這個問題吧?在這里跟大家溝通分享下我對與runtime機制的理解。 要理解runtime,首先我們要了解類和對象的內部結構,下面將首先介紹下OC中類與對象的結構層次。 一、首先,從 runtime.h頭文件 ...
本文將分五個部分來分析和總結Redis的內部機制,分別是:Redis數據庫、Redis客戶端、Redis事件、Redis服務器的初始化步驟、Redis命令的執行過程。 首先介紹一下Redis服務器的狀態結構。Redis使用一個類型為“redisServer”的數據結構來保存整個Redis ...